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Practical Metal Polishing - Frequently, metal finishing is required for a pleasing appearance and for clean-room usage. It's one of the most favored techniques due to its usefulness in intensifying the natural beauty of the items, as an example, motor bike parts, automobile parts or cookware. Moreover, numerous clean-rooms must have a shiny finish in order to limit the permeability of the metal surfaces which often can cause debris to gather and contaminate. An excellent example of this practice might be in a vacuum chamber. There are lots of methods of finish metals, and here we can go over a little pertaining to some of the techniques involved. Various metals can be finished manually, with purpose made buffing machines, electromechanically or utilizing chemicals. A special finishing compound or paste is regularly utilized, that can include limestone, aluminum oxide, dolomite, chalk, chromium oxide, tripoli, or iron oxide. Polishing stainless steel, due to its poor thermal conductivity, somewhat high viscosity, and hardness is among the most time intensive. On the contrary, items fabricated from non-ferrous metal are definitely more receptive to polishing, mainly because these call for the least amount of treatments.
If a superior processing quality isn't required, quicker pad speeds can be employed. A lesser pad speed can be used should a top quality mirror finish is critical. Finishing buffs plastered in paste will be somewhat impacted by the forces on the pad. The force of the surface pressure may be amplified to a definite extent, having said that, going beyond the perfect degree of load not just cuts down on the quality of the process, but also can degrade efficiency, might cause wear to the part, and there's also a tangible heating of the work-pieces, because of friction. When you are using thin metal, it will be elevated temperature (and a corresponding pliability of the metal) that can induce materials to distort, twist or buckle. Typically, it takes a skilled technician to consider all these elements to both avoid harm to the piece and to operate correctly. To appreciably improve the quality of the completed surface, the finishing operation should be performed with significantly less aggression and not so much pressure in an effort to finally deliver a surface area that is free of scratches or fine lines left behind by the finishing process, thereby ending up with a lovely mirror finish.
